    Sports history and the modern reality of the current anti-trans legislation fight collide in a state where women's sport mattered for decades before Title IX. Since 1920, girl's high school athletics was administered by the Iowa Girls High School Athletic Union. The IGHSAU is recognized as one of the oldest confederations dedicated to opening doors in sports for girls in the world. It began with its well-known, and well-attended annual state girls high school basketball tournament, but it grew over the decades to build a full slate of competition for Iowa girls pre-dating the passage of Title IX “I take a lot of pride that every girl walks down every main street in every town in Iowa just as tall as the boy.” -- IGHSAU executive secretary/legend E. Wayne Cooley Jr., 2002 In 2014, IGHSAU was among the first states in the USA to form policy for the inclusion of transgender girls into high school sport. Again, Iowa leading the way.     Maxwell Nagle is young promising journalist covering the his favorite game. He's a high school basketball writer for Novahoops.com, based one of the nation's basketball hotbeds, the DMV (District of Columbia-Maryland-Virginia) But he's only a few years remove from his time as a three-point bombardier at Hollins University in Roanoke, Virginia. As Nagle was helping Hollins through the difficult Old Dominion Athletic Conference, he was also working through finding his place as a transgender man on the court and off, while playing ball at an all-women university. The examination led to a choice entering senior year between love for self and a love for the game. Nagle sit in with Karleigh Webb to look at how sport influenced his journey, what he took from the experience and how sports could adapt and grow to help trans student-athletes in the years ahead.
